## Seat-Map Renderer

Quick note for the sync: the Larkspur Playhouse seat-map renderer now draws balcony tiers from the same grid config as orchestra seats, so no more duplicate layout files. Zooming is still a bit janky on older tablets — fix is in review. The rendering architecture notes live here.

runbook for tafof-yawif: https://confluence.tolvaqsys.internal/display/display/browse/pages/7be3

FAQ: How do I upgrade my plugin for Quillbus 4? Quillbus 4 replaces the legacy fanout API with typed channels, so plugin authors must recompile against the new SDK and declare channel schemas explicitly. Old-style consumers keep working for one release cycle, then fail at registration. If your plugin's migration sandbox locks you out mid-upgrade, restore access with the recovery passphrase that follows.

unlock words, tahof-kawip: eliath-sorix-wenius

Subject: Thumbcache leak — hotfix cut

Team,

The Glimmerpane image cache leaks roughly 40 MB/hour under sustained scroll. Root cause: evicted bitmaps held by the decoder pool. Fix merged, soak test passed overnight on the Varnholt rig. Requesting expedited sign-off for tonight's train. Hotfix build token follows below.

— Release eng

trace token, fafog-kageg: htk4_98e6

The renewal of our three-year agreement with Torvane Materials has been assessed in detail. Proposed terms include a 4.2% unit-price increase, partially offset by improved volume rebates and extended payment terms of sixty days. Sensitivity analysis indicates a net annual cost impact of under 1% on the Meridia product line, assuming stable demand. Legal has flagged no material changes to liability clauses. We recommend approval, subject to the conditions outlined in the confidential note below.

confidential, yawip-bahif: Zorokox Partners plans to lower the Casax list price by 28.0 percent in April. The board signed off on a budget of $271.0 million for Project Juldor. The renewal with Pelokox Partners closes at $410.1 million a year, 3.4 percent below the last contract. Project Pelok slips by a full year because of the audit delay.